Product Description

A beautifully hand-carved antique Japanese ivory netsuke depicting a geisha playing a musical instrument, gracefully posed with a fan and traditional shamisen. Standing at 5cm tall, this finely detailed piece captures the elegance and cultural significance of the geisha in Japanese art.

The netsuke features delicate coloring on the kimono and hair, and is signed by the artist, adding authenticity and collectible appeal. A graceful, expressive example of traditional Japanese craftsmanship.

Netsuke were functional yet artistic toggles used during the Edo and Meiji periods to secure personal belongings to kimono sashes. Geisha figures were popular motifs, symbolizing grace, refinement, and Japan’s rich cultural heritage.
